What was your favorite moment from Raw?
Eric Stites
I enjoyed the women’s gauntlet match. It wasn’t too long in my opinion and it had plenty of good wrestling. I’ll be honest and say that I didn’t really like what happened to set up this gauntlet match. I think the match itself was pretty entertaining. Natalya’s victory is very intriguing. She’s facing Ronda for the title next week, and may have been foreshadowing for a Natalya heel turn. Good finish to the show.
Steven Lugo
Women’s gauntlet match. Although I would have liked a different result (to see Sasha win and face Rousey next week), the match quality was good. Also, it was a welcome change from the usual core of women who have been main-eventing Raw since forever. It’s as simple as, I enjoy several straight minutes of in-ring action with something on the line. Seeing Natalya win–maybe that’s a reward for having to put up with the tasteless storyline of her deceased father being mocked by Ruby?
JP Wood
I was impressed with the overall flow of the show. Although, it had its issues and questions left unanswered. The McMahon family reunion, in particular, has given rise to a seemingly infinite number of new questions about what all of the nonsense they said actually means.
Despite that, I finally had a Raw where I didn’t feel like my patience had expired early in hour two. Three hours is still a long show, but this time it felt like less, not more.
Kyle Payne
There were several moments that made me happy on Raw. The first was definitely seeing Tyler Breeze getting some TV time and looking good in a competitive match with Dean Ambrose. ‘Prince Pretty’ has long been overlooked and underutilized. It’s my hope this is a sign of things changing. Another moment that brought a smile to my face was the fact that The Revival won a fatal 4 way tag team match to earn a title shot against Bobby Roode and Chad Gable. Given a good amount of time, the four of them can steal the show at whatever event this title match takes.
Then there was the Women’s Gauntlet match. The match had stakes, a title shot next Raw against Ronda Rousey, and it was competitive. All the women had their moment to shine and each one of them kept me engaged in the match. Natalya winning was a welcomed surprise. If given enough time for the match, Ronda and Natayla could steal the show. Natalya can give Rousey an exciting match and take her to another level.
